What You Will Be Doing
- Managing and debugging the Azure cloud infrastructure on a daily basis
- upkeep and expansion of our portfolio of API products
- support for front-end application infrastructure
- Resolving issues with front-end applications and managing software Backend services creation and design
- Maintenance and structuring of the code repository
- Updates and monitoring for Azure cloud environment's security and operations
- Revisions to the API documentation
- Cloud data architecture and maintenance updates to the architectural and environment wiki
- Development, supervision, troubleshooting, and maintenance of Docker and containerized applications across multiple implementations
- Scalability of applications and cost-effectiveness of Azure
What You Need for this Position
- Extensive experience with Python, API design, Docker or similar containerized approaches, Azure cloud infrastructure, scaling services including Kubernetes, and frontend technologies such as React.
- Ability and drive to immerse yourself in new technologies as needed.
- Proven experience and passion for architecting enterprise software systems with auto-scaling.
- Familiarity with offerings from Microsoft Azure Cloud and experience deploying cloud-based applications. Experience across multiple environments is desirable.
- Familiarity with common machine learning and computer vision concepts and/or past experience in machine learning operations (MLOps). Experience with deep learning frameworks such as PyTorch and Tensorflow is a plus.
- An understanding of and experience designing security frameworks for cloud-based data and services.
- Experience selecting and implementing authentication services for end users and API clients.
